Shrikant (Ingalhalikar) >>>>> ji's third and last field guide in the series, aptly named as 'Final >>>>> Flowers of Sahyadri' will be released on 21 March 2014 - a day auspicious >>>>> to people of our kind - the 'World Forest Day'. >>>>> >>>>> Shrikant ji has been working endlessly, more so for the last two years >>>>> to get the final lot of flowers into this new book. I and Prashant have >>>>> been fortunate to join him during his explorations, and have benefited >>>>> from >>>>> every trip. But I must say every trip did not benefit him necessarily. >>>>> Several times he would need to go in successive weeks or so to find the >>>>> plants blooming! In some cases, it would be successive years! >>>>> >>>>> Some details of the new book that I know from him: "It will contain >>>>> 800 new species of flowering plants of north Western Ghats. With this >>>>> third >>>>> and last field guide in the series, documentation of 2200 species from >>>>> this >>>>> hot spot habitat gets completed. Grasses and sedges are not in scope of >>>>> this set of 3 field guides. Besides the 800 species (530 wild and 270 >>>>> cultivated), the new guide also enlists and gives identification help for >>>>> about 100 species of Palms and Conifers of this region." >>>>> >>>>> He is launching a website too ... http://www.flowersofsahyadri.in/ on >>>>> 1st March 2014, which would have all the information and updates related >>>>> to >>>>> books authored by him.
